DNA Script Raises $38.5 Million in Series B Financing

Oversubscribed round led by LSP will fund accelerated product development and commercial operations in the U.S.

PARIS – DNA Script today announced an oversubscribed Series B fundraising of $38.5M led by LSP, one of Europe’s largest and most experienced healthcare investment firms. Bpifrance, through its Large Venture fund, joined the round, alongside existing investors Illumina Ventures, M. Ventures, Sofinnova Partners, Kurma Partners and Idinvest Partners. The proceeds will enable DNA Script to accelerate the development of the company’s first products based on its industry-leading enzymatic technology for de novo synthesis of nucleic acids. The company is prioritizing the recruitment of top talent in the U.S. for its product development and commercialization teams in preparation for product launch, as well as on expanding its Paris-based research team.

DNA Script’s innovative technology provides affordable, rapid, high-quality production of important genomic experimental precursors, such as oligonucleotides. The technology overcomes many of the inefficiencies of today’s synthetic DNA production. It features a novel biochemical process for nucleic acids synthesis based on the use of highly efficient enzymes, thus enabling enhanced performance while minimizing the use of harsh chemicals. The product portfolio based on DNA Script’s proprietary enzymatic synthesis platform will enable molecular biology researchers to accelerate their experiments — with the goal of moving from design to results within a day for a broad range of applications.

“In less than two years since our last financing round, the DNA Script team has developed enzymatic synthesis technology at an incredibly fast pace and extended the company’s lead in this exciting and quickly expanding sector. As we announced earlier this year at the AGBT General Meeting, DNA Script was the first company to enzymatically synthesize a 200mer oligo de novo with an average coupling efficiency that rivals the best organic chemical processes in use today. Our technology is now reliable enough for its first commercial applications, which we believe will deliver the promise of same-day results to researchers everywhere, with DNA synthesis that can be completed in just a few hours,” said Thomas Ybert, CEO and cofounder of DNA Script.

About DNA Script
Founded in 2014 in Paris, DNA Script is the world’s leading company in manufacturing de novo synthetic nucleic acids using an enzymatic technology. The company aims at accelerating innovation in life sciences and technology through rapid, affordable, and high-quality DNA synthesis. DNA Script’s approach leverages nature’s billions of years of evolution in synthesizing DNA to enable genome scale synthesis. The Company’s technology has the potential to greatly accelerate the development of new therapeutics, sustainable chemicals production, improved crops as well as data storage.

About LSP
LSP (Life Sciences Partners) is an independent European investment firm, providing financing for private and public life sciences companies. LSP’s mission is to connect investors to inventors, focusing on unmet medical needs. Since the late 1980s, LSP’s management has invested in about 100 innovative enterprises, many of which have grown to become leaders of the global life sciences industry. With over €2.0 billion ($2.3 billion) of investment capital raised to date and offices in Amsterdam, Munich and Boston, LSP is one of Europe’s leading life sciences investors. About Bpifrance and the Large Venture fund
Bpifrance is the French national investment bank: it finances businesses – at every stage of their development – through loans, guarantees, equity investments and export insurances. Bpifrance also provides extrafinancial services (training, consultancy…) to help entrepreneurs meet their challenges (innovation, export…). Large Venture is a EUR 1 billion fund dedicated to innovative companies in healthcare, IT and greentech sectors. The fund is able to invest amounts greater than EUR 10 million and thus ensures the equity financing continuum of the venture capital actors who invest earlier in the development of the company.

About Idinvest Partners
Idinvest Partners is a leading European mid-market private equity firm. With €8bn under management, the firm has developed several areas of expertise including innovative startup venture capital transactions; mid-market private debt, i.e. single-tranche, senior and subordinated debt; primary and secondary investment and private equity advisory services. Founded in 1997, Idinvest Partners used to belong to the Allianz Group until 2010, when it branched out as an independent firm. In January 2018, Idinvest Partners became a subsidiary of Eurazeo, a leading global investment company, with a diversified portfolio of €17bn in assets under management, including approximately €11bn from investment partners, invested in over 350 companies.
